Titanium exhibits a unique combination of properties including excellent corrosion resistance, high temperature resistance, and outstanding strength to weight ratios. Titanium is produced as commercially pure or alloyed. Commercially pure titanium is typically used in implantable medical applications whereas the titanium alloys are produced with the addition of vanadium or aluminum for applications such as aerospace. Hamilton Precision Metals processes strip and foil products in Titanium CP (Grade 1, Grade 2, Grade 4) and Titanium 3Al-2.5V (Grade 9).

Hamilton Precision Metals is the world leader of precision-rolled foil and ultra-light gauge strip in any alloy. This includes stainless steel foil, titanium foil, nickel foil, copper based foil, cobalt based foil, Constantan® foil, Evanohm® foil, and many other alloys. Metal foil is generally defined as strip 0.004” (0.1016 mm) and below. Cold rolling strip to these extremely thin gauges demands extensive rolling expertise to manufacture with precision and consistency. The term metal bellows refers to a structure that is composed of one or more stainless steel sleeves fitted into one another and is rendered elastic by the introduction of parallel corrugations. Metal bellows can be arranged to complete combinations of metal bellows (expansion joints). Thus, every specific requirement can be met. As raw material for the sleeve production, stainless steel strips or sheets with a thickness of 0.15 - 3 mm in the standard grades are used: 1.4541 / AISI 321 1.4571 / AISI 316Ti 1.4404 / AISI 316L 1.4307 / AISI 304L                                                              material with high chemical resistance and temperature resistance:   1.4435 / AISI 316L 1.4539 / AL 904L 1.4878 / AISI 321H 1.4828 / AISI 309 1.4462 / AISI 318 LN 1.4410 / AISI F53 or additional special materials:      1.4876 / Incoloy 800HT 2.4858 / Incoloy 825 2.4856 / Inconel 625 2.4816 / Inconel 600 2.4610 / Hastelloy C-4 2.4819 / Hastelloy C-276 2.4602 / Hastelloy C-22 3.7035 / Tit

Applications of Carbon Steel Sheets The applications of carbon steel sheets are quite extensive. Here are some examples: Construction: Carbon steel sheets are widely used in large construction projects for structural frames, bridges, and more. Automotive Industry: They are employed in the automotive industry for chassis and body components. Maritime: Due to their resistance to seawater, carbon steel sheets are used in shipbuilding. Power Plants: Carbon steel sheets serve as durable coating materials in power plants, withstanding high temperatures and pressures. Advantages of Carbon Steel Sheets Carbon steel sheets offer several advantages: Cost Efficiency: They are more cost-effective compared to other materials. High Strength: Carbon steel sheets have the capacity to withstand heavy loads. Wide Range of Applications: They are adaptable to various applications across different industries. Rubber Steel is a kind of Flexible Magnetic ReceptiveMaterials, magnets stick to it! Rubber Steel is made by iron powder and high quality thermoplastics. It is a kind of Magnetic Receptive Material, it is ideal for multiple applications at school, home, office or POP display etc. Magnetic Receptive – It is an ideal attraction base like steel for holding magnetic sheet, magnet strip or hard magnet, no restriction on pole alignment. Flexible – It is as flexible as rubber sheet, easy to lays flat, and can be applied to either flat or curved surface, won’t crease. Easy to use – It can be easily stamp, score, drill, hand – cut with knife or scissors without damaging its magnetic receptive properties. Easy to laminate – It is easy to laminate paper or PVC or self adhesive to the rubber steel to create more application as you need. Easy to apply – Adhesive backing attaches easily to metal, wood, plastic, or any smooth surfaces. Safer to us - Rubber Steel is lightweight and has no sharp edge, so it safer to use comparing to metal steel with sharp edges. Rustproof Durable, long last and easy to store. SS 430 is a corrosion and heat resistant ferritic Chromium Steel. It can be polished to appear similar to Chromium plate. The material is magnetic in both annealed and cold rolled tempers. The alloy can be readily blanked and formed. The material can be resistance welded, brazed, and soldered. SS 430 is resistant to atmospheric corrosion and fresh water, but it not resistant to most salts and sea water. It is resistant to scaling by oxidation up to about 1400°F. Available Sizes: SS 430 is available from Hamilton Precision Metals as strip product in thicknesses from 0.001” to 0.050” (0.0254 mm to 1.27 mm) in widths up to 12.0” (304.8 mm). The material conforms to ASTM A240, FED QQS 766, and UNS S43000.

SS 420 is a heat treatable martensitic chromium stainless steel. Melt practice is controlled to develop a surface nearly free from defects. It provides the best combination of wear resistance and corrosion resistance, and is used in demanding medical accessories, such as high quality surgical instruments. The alloy can be cold formed from the annealed temper.Welding should be accomplished by pre and post heating.Pre-heating at 450° F and post-heated at 1300° F will prevent cracking. The corrosion resistance is optimized in the heat treated temper and assured by passiviation. It is resistant to water and organic materials. Oxidation resistance remains favorable in most applications up through 1200°F.

SS 316L is an austenitic Chromium-Nickel stainless steel with superior corrosion resistance. The low carbon content reduces susceptibility to carbide precipitation during welding. This permits usage in severe corrosive environments such as isolator diaphragms, and metal diaphragms, for both aerospace sensors and burst discs. The alloy can be formed from the annealed temper by stamping and deep drawing. Joining is accomplished by brazing and welding. The Molybdenum is the alloy composition provides excellent strength up through 800° F in applications. Available Sizes: SS 316L is available from Hamilton Precision Metals as strip product from 0.0005” to 0.050” (0.0127 mm to 1.27 mm) in widths up to 12.0” (304.8 mm). It is also available in foil as thin as 0.000200” (0.00508 mm) in widths of 4.0” (101.6 mm) maximum. The material conforms to AMS 5507, ASTM A240, FED QQS766 and UNS S31603.

SS 305 is an austenitic Chromium-Nickel stainless steel with excellent corrosion resistance, and is suitable for very severe cold forming operations. A high nickel content reduces the work hardening rate so that it can be formed into electronic components and remain non-magnetic. The alloy is readily formable and work hardens slowly.It has good resistance to nitric and sulfuric acid solutions although it will not resist halogen acids. The alloy can be satisfactorily welded, brazed, and soldered. Available Sizes: SS 305 is available from Hamilton Precision Metals as strip product in thicknesses from 0.0005” to 0.050” (0.0127 mm to 1.27 mm) in widths up to 12.0” (304.8 mm). It is also available in foil as thin as 0.000200” (0.00508 mm) in widths of 4.0” (101.6 mm) maximum. The material conforms to ASTM A240, QQS-766, and UNS S30500.

SS 304L is an austenitic Chromium-Nickel stainless steel offering the optimum combination of corrosion resistance, strength, and ductility. These attributes make it a favorite for many mechanical switch components, and use in surgical instruments. Low carbon content reduces susceptibility to carbide precipitation during welding. The alloy is readily formed in the annealed temper.SS 304L may be joined by all commonly used brazing and welding methods including oxyacetylene. The corrosive resistance to acids is generally very good with the exception of halogen acids. Available Sizes: SS 304L is available from Hamilton Precision Metals as strip product in thicknesses from 0.0005” to 0.050” (0.0127 mm to 1.27 mm) in widths up to 12.0” (304.8 mm). It is also available in foil as thin as 0.000200” (0.00508 mm) in widths of 4.0” (101.6 mm) maximum. The material conforms to ASTM A240, ASTM A666, FED QQ-S-766, MIL-S-4043, UNS S30403.
